A good first quarter of 2022 and new CEO

2022 is off to a good start for AGROINTELLI. Today, we are happy to announce that from the 1st of April, Jens Brylle has officially started as CEO at AGROINTELLI. He has a wide range of executive experience, including VP of Sales & Market Development at Hardi International, the Danish manufacturer of sprayers. He helped Hardi to scale up internationally, and now is going to support AGROINTELLI in its commercial journey.

A good start to the year 

The first quarter of 2022 was very positive for AGROINTELLI. The company has successfully broadened the distribution network around the world. Australia, Hungary, Romania, Serbia, Poland, Italy and Austria are the countries that have been added to the distributors’ list as of late. To ensure the trend continues, a leader with a strong commercial focus and experience in the agricultural industry was needed. We are happy to share with you that it was possible to match the candidate to fit the current state of the company.  

A former VP of Hardi International joins as CEO 

Jens Brylle is 62 years old and comes from Dragør, Denmark. He has recently spent 12 years as a Senior Director Global Account at LM Wind Power, and before that, 13 years in sales and market development at Hardi International, which is one of the leading manufacturers of agricultural sprayers worldwide. He understands the industry AGROINTELLI operates in, and has deep insights and experience selling agricultural machinery directly, through dealers and building up global dealer networks.
